Page MenuHomePhabricator

UploadWizard: property panel added via "Add statement" persists when you upload another image
Closed, ResolvedPublicBUG REPORT

Description

Steps to reproduce:

  • add a new image using UploadWizard
  • in the metadata step click the 'Add statement' button to create a new property panel
  • finish submitting the image
  • click 'Upload more files'
  • add a new image
  • in the metadata step the new property panel you created when uploading the last file will be there

Event Timeline

Ramsey-WMF triaged this task as Medium priority.Jul 3 2019, 6:50 PM
Ramsey-WMF changed the subtype of this task from "Task" to "Bug Report".
Ramsey-WMF moved this task from Untriaged to Next up on the Multimedia board.

Change 522056 had a related patch set uploaded (by Cparle; owner: Cparle):
[mediawiki/extensions/UploadWizard@master] Delete non-default properties from the DOM after submission

https://gerrit.wikimedia.org/r/522056

Change 522056 merged by jenkins-bot:
[mediawiki/extensions/UploadWizard@master] Delete non-default properties from the DOM after submission

https://gerrit.wikimedia.org/r/522056

Just tested on production and the issue is still there. I wonder though...should we keep it? It could be seen as a convenience.

Fixed on production.